Unique Corporate Structure Creates Unprecedented Tensions

The company's unique structure, which combines a non-profit board overseeing a for-profit subsidiary, has created unprecedented tensions in the tech industry. This hybrid model has proven increasingly complex as OpenAI scales its operations and attracts significant investment.

Recent months have highlighted several key challenges with this arrangement:

  • Balancing billions in investment with the stated mission of ensuring artificial general intelligence benefits all of humanity
  • Managing board composition and decision-making processes that have become focal points for AI governance discussions
  • Addressing corporate responsibility concerns while maintaining operational flexibility
  • Navigating conflicting interests between profit motives and mission-driven goals

The organization's governance model has become a critical case study for how AI companies can structure themselves to balance commercial success with broader societal responsibilities.

Competitive Landscape and Strategic Partnerships

The competitive landscape has intensified significantly, with major tech giants investing heavily in AI research and development. Microsoft's substantial partnership with OpenAI represents both an opportunity and a challenge for the company's future direction.

Major competitive dynamics include:

  • Google, Microsoft, and Meta investing billions in AI research and development
  • Microsoft's reported $13 billion investment in OpenAI, strengthening the company's financial position
  • Questions about independence and conflicting interests arising from the Microsoft partnership
  • The broader challenge of maintaining mission-driven goals while securing necessary funding for expensive AI research

This relationship exemplifies the complex balance between securing adequate resources for cutting-edge research while maintaining organizational independence and mission alignment.
